“He who overcomes, and he who keeps my works to the end, to him I will give authority over the nations.”
— WEB
“And he that overcometh, and keepeth my works unto the end, to him will I give power over the nations:”
— KJV
“And he that overcometh, and he that keepeth my works unto the end, to him will I give authority over the nations:”
— ASV
And--implying the close connection of the promise to the conqueror that follows, with the preceding exhortation, Rev 2:25. and keepeth--Greek, "and he that keepeth." Compare the same word in the passage already alluded to by the Lord, Act 15:28-29, end. my works--in contrast to "her (English Version, 'their') works" (Rev 2:22). The works which I command and which are the fruit of My Spirit. unto the end-- (Mat 24:13). The image is perhaps from the race, wherein it is not enough to enter the lists, but the runner must persevere to the end. give power--Greek, "authority." over the nations--at Christ's coming the saints shall possess the kingdom "under the whole heaven"; therefore over this earth; compare Luk 19:17, "have thou authority [the same word as here] over ten cities."
— Jamieson-Fausset-Brown Commentary (public domain)
